In the first half of their game against the Broncos, the New Orleans Saints lost starting cornerback Paulson Adebo for the remainder of the game with a knee injury. In the second half, they lost their other starting corner. 

Late in the third quarter, the Saints ruled Marshon Lattimore out for the remainder of the game with a hamstring injury. Lattimore recorded four tackles in the game before his injury. 

Undrafted rookie Rico Payton took Lattimore's place in the lineup. 

Lattimore missed most of training camp with a hamstring injury, but had appeared in each of the Saints' seven games so far this season. 

He was off to a strong start in 2024, having allowed only nine completions on 16 passes in which he was the closest defender in coverage, according to Pro Football Reference.
